

Denny Darl Cowan, 79, of Tyler peacefully entered the Kingdom of Heaven on August 14, 2021, surrounded by his loving family following a courageous battle with cancer. Denny was born July 16, 1942, to his mother, Ina Walker Cowan and father, William Crook Cowan in Tyler, TX. He devoted his life to his faith, his family, and his friends.
Denny was an Air Force veteran and touched many lives as an educator of 48 years with the Tyler Independent School District. The following has been used to describe him by former students and those who knew him best – “above and beyond,” “expected nothing but the best,” “source of joy and laughter,” and “example of commitment.”
